> You can make a symbolic link and secure one of the URLs, e.g.:
>
> ln -s htsearch htsearch.pr
>
> and then in your server config:
> <Location /cgi-bin/htsearch.pr>
> AuthType Basic
As I understand it, there is no real security here: anyone can setup a form in a Web
page which will call htsearch (not htsearch.pr) and this htsearch will be able to read
the configuration file for the private database?
